EDF Renewable Energy acquires groSolar

News

EDF Renewable Energy have announced the acquisition of Global Resource Options, Inc. (dba: groSolar), a privately owned company, which provides development and turnkey engineering, procurement, and construction (EPC) of solar photovoltaic (PV) projects for developers, financiers, utilities, corporate, government, and other institutional clients.  The acquisition brings to EDF RE an autonomous business unit with a precise focus on distributed generation solar business to meet the growing demands of corporate customers seeking cost-effective renewable energy sources.  Closing is subject to customary conditions precedent.

Since its founding in 1998, groSolar has designed, built, procured equipment and installed more than 150 megawatts (MW) (2,000 installations) of solar PV systems across the US.  All with one goal in mind -- to provide customers with the most competitively priced, highest quality, on-time solar system to meet or surpass customer needs. The company's strength lies in their commitment to work in partnership with clients and local stakeholders, managing every step of the process in order to simplify solar development.

"We are very pleased to welcome groSolar to the EDF RE family.  The company brings to EDF RE the ability to offer competitively priced distributed generation solar solutions to the growing Municipal, University, School and Hospital (MUSH), corporate, and utility customer base," stated Tristan Grimbert, CEO and President of EDF RE.  "The addition of an established and successful distributed generation business line contributes to our long-term growth plan to diversify the customer base and augments a comprehensive range of energy services that the EDF group offers to its customers worldwide."

"groSolar benefits from the ability to leverage EDF RE's deep technical resources and project development experience while remaining an independent subsidiary," stated Jamie Resor, CEO of groSolar.  "We worked collaboratively during the due diligence process to ensure that our respective cultures and customer oriented focus would fully align.  And today we look forward with confidence to accelerate our reach in the expanding distributed generation solar market as part of EDF RE."

EDF Renewable Energy is one of the largest renewable energy developers in North America with 8 gigawatts (GW) of wind, solar, biomass, biogas, and storage projects developed and an installed capacity of 4.1 GW.  As part of the EDF Group, EDF RE works closely with EDF Energy Services and DK Energy.
